#d6db1b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d6db1b is composed of 83.9% red, 85.9%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.7%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 61.6 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 48.2%. #d6db1b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ff36 with #adb700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#d6db1b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090901 is the darkest color, while #fefef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6db1b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7c7a is the less saturated color, while #e8ee08 is the most saturated one.
